System.DateUtils.EndOfADay

Aus RAD Studio API Documentation
Wechseln zu: Navigation, Suche

Delphi

function EndOfADay(const AYear, ADayOfYear: Word): TDateTime;
function EndOfADay(const AYear, AMonth, ADay: Word): TDateTime;

C++

extern DELPHI_PACKAGE System::TDateTime __fastcall EndOfADay(const System::Word AYear, const System::Word ADayOfYear)/* overload */;

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
function public
System.DateUtils.pas
System.DateUtils.hpp
System.DateUtils System.DateUtils

Beschreibung

Gibt einen TDateTime-Wert zurück, mit dem die letzte Millisekunde des angegebenen Tages repräsentiert wird.

EndOfADay gibt die letzte Millisekunde (23:59:59.999 Uhr) eines angegebenen Tages zurück.

Der Parameter AYear gibt das Jahr mit dem gewünschten Tag an.

Der Parameter ADayOfYear gibt den gewünschten Tag als Tag im Jahr an. Dabei entspricht 1 dem 1. Januar, 2 dem 2. Januar, 32 dem 1. Februar usw.

Die Parameter AMonth und ADay geben den gewünschten Tag über den Monat und den Tag im Monat an. Gültige Werte für AMonth liegen zwischen 1 und 12. Die Werte für ADay liegen zwischen 1 und 28, 29, 30 oder 31 (dieser Wertebereich ist von den Werten in AYear und AMonth abhängig.

Geben die Parameter kein gültiges Datum an, löst EndOfADay eine EConvertError-Exception aus.

Siehe auch

Codebeispiele